Key Insights of Japan Logistics Real Estate Market

  • Market Size (2023): Estimated at approximately ¥4.5 trillion (~$40 billion), reflecting robust demand driven by e-commerce and manufacturing sectors.
  • Forecast Value (2026): Projected to reach ¥6.2 trillion (~$55 billion), with a CAGR of around 12% from 2023 to 2026.
  • Leading Segment: Warehousing and distribution centers dominate, accounting for over 70% of total market activity, driven by logistics automation and urban distribution needs.
  • Core Application: E-commerce fulfillment and just-in-time manufacturing logistics are primary drivers, necessitating high-spec, strategically located facilities.
  • Leading Geography: Greater Tokyo and Osaka regions hold over 60% market share, benefiting from dense industrial clusters and transportation infrastructure.
  • Key Market Opportunity: Rising demand for urban logistics hubs in secondary cities presents significant growth potential, especially in Nagoya and Fukuoka.
  • Major Companies: Prologis, GLP, Goodman Group, and Mitsubishi Estate dominate, with strategic acquisitions and joint ventures fueling expansion.

Japan Logistics Real Estate Market Dynamics and Trends

The Japanese logistics real estate sector is experiencing a paradigm shift driven by technological innovation, demographic changes, and evolving consumer behaviors. Urbanization continues to intensify, prompting a surge in demand for last-mile delivery centers within metropolitan areas. The rise of e-commerce has accelerated the need for high-quality, flexible warehousing solutions, often integrated with automation and smart technologies.

Additionally, Japan’s aging population influences labor availability and operational costs, prompting investors to prioritize automation and robotics in logistics facilities. The sector’s maturity is evident in the increasing adoption of sustainable building practices, energy-efficient designs, and green certifications. Cross-border trade and regional supply chain realignment further bolster the sector’s resilience, positioning Japan as a strategic logistics hub in Asia-Pacific. Market players are actively exploring redevelopment opportunities, especially in prime urban zones, to meet escalating demand and optimize land use.

Market Challenges and Risks in Japan Logistics Real Estate

Despite promising growth prospects, the sector faces notable challenges. Land scarcity in prime urban areas limits new development, driving up land prices and construction costs. Regulatory complexities and zoning restrictions can delay project timelines and inflate budgets. Demographic shifts, particularly an aging workforce, pose operational risks, necessitating increased automation investments.

Market volatility driven by global economic uncertainties, trade tensions, and supply chain disruptions also impact investment stability. Additionally, climate change-related risks, such as flooding and natural disasters, require resilient infrastructure planning. Competition among major players intensifies, potentially compressing profit margins and reducing market entry opportunities for new entrants. Strategic risk mitigation, including diversification and technological adoption, is essential for sustainable growth in Japan’s logistics real estate landscape.
